Ferdinand VII gold 8 Escudos 1811/0 Mo-HJ MS63 NGC, Mexico City mint, KM160, Cal-1784, Onza-1256. A surprisingly fleeting overdate within the late colonial Mexican gold series, altogether missing from the Norweb, Gerber, and Eliasberg collections, with the Rudman example only certifying as a mere AU58. Tied with another example as the finest certified, between the three Mint state examples in the NGC and PCGS census. Boasting frosty, razor-sharp devices upon reflective semi-Prooflike fields, this specimen has it all.
